The SN74AHCT367NSR is a high-performance logic IC chip designed by Texas Instruments, belonging to the 74AHCT series. This 16-pin surface-mount device is a non-inverting buffer with two elements, each capable of handling 2 or 4 bits (Hex). It operates within a supply voltage range of 4.5V to 5.5V, ensuring compatibility with a wide range of digital systems. The SN74AHCT367NSR is packaged in a Tape & Reel (TR) format, making it suitable for automated assembly processes.
SN74AHCT367NSR Features
High-Performance Logic: The SN74AHCT367NSR offers robust performance with a supply voltage range of 4.5V to 5.5V, making it ideal for applications requiring stable and reliable operation within this voltage range.
Dual Elements: The device features two non-inverting buffer elements, each capable of handling 2 or 4 bits (Hex), providing flexibility in circuit design.
Surface Mount Technology: The surface-mount package type ensures ease of integration into modern PCB designs, facilitating compact and efficient layouts.
High Current Capability: With an output current capability of 8mA for both high and low states, the SN74AHCT367NSR can drive multiple loads effectively.
Compliance and Safety: The SN74AHCT367NSR is REACH unaffected and RoHS3 compliant, ensuring it meets environmental and safety standards. Additionally, it has a Moisture Sensitivity Level (MSL) of 1, making it suitable for unlimited storage conditions.
Obsolete Status: While the SN74AHCT367NSR is marked as obsolete, it remains a reliable choice for legacy systems and applications where its specific features are required.
